Two years ago I researched the availability of IPA fonts for the Macintosh,
and I found lots of information on AppleLink. The following, although not
up to date, should provide good pointers for more research. I suppose that
this information should probably be archived as a report, due to length,
but I'll leave that for the moderators to decide!

DESCRIPTION:
A collection of 22 fonts that include numerical systems and
alphabet of many foreign languages.
These fonts range from ancient to modern, From Western to
Eastern, and from national to International. The archaic
includes: Tanis-Egyptian Hieroglyphics, Arpad-ancient Aramaic, a
forerunner of modern Hebrew, Persepolis-old Persian cuneiform, and
Mycenae-Minoan Cretan Linear B syllabary, thought to be a
forerunner of early Greek writings. Two forms of Greek text fonts
are included, each with accents and aspirations: Sparta-a bold,
heavy faced Greek font, and Delphi-a lighter faced Greek font.
Also, two different versions of Hebrew fonts are included: Tel
Aviv-classic text font, and Haifa-modern cursive Hebrew font. An
Arabic font Riyadh is included complete with variant forms based
on letter position in a word. Yerevan font is designed to be a
useful Armenian text. Vladivostok font offers a very complete
version of the Cyrillic alphabet, including letters from obsolete
Russian, as well as Byelorussian, Ukrainian, Serbian, Bulgarian
and other related languages. Prague (with emphasis on East
European Slavic languages using a Latin alphabet: Polish, Czech,
Slovene, Slovak) and Budapest (with its coverage of Hungarian,
Turkish and Finnish) round out the Eastern European
languages. Dusseldorf (a font for German text), Limerick (a font
for Old Irish Gaelic) and Trizekh (for Esperanto and Devonian
writings) allow one to compose in these variant forms of the Latin
alphabet. Lunaria font was designed as a universal font to allow
almost all types of accents known in Latin-based alphabets. IPA is
based directly on the characters devised by the International
Phonetics Association. The Asian continent is represented as well
with fonts designed for several of these languages:
Seoul(Korean), Bangkok (Thai), and Luang Phrabang (Laotian). As an
added bonus, the disk contains Rivendell, a font for Tolkien
Tengwar and Angertha runes.

DESCRIPTION:
Contains four ImageWriter I and II international fonts that include
Roman, Greek, Cyrillic and Phonetic in 12 and 24 point size.
International Roman handles the following languages, among
others: English, Dutch, Frisian, Afrikaans, German, Danish,
Norwegian(both Dano-Norwegian and New-Norwegian), Swedish,
Icelandic, Faroese, Irish, Welsh, Scottish, Latin, Portuguese,
Spanish, Catalan, French, Italian, Romanian, Polish, Czech,
Slovak, Slovene, Serbo-Croatian, Latvian, Lithuanian, Albanian,
Estonian, Finnish, Hungarian, Maltese, Turkish, Basque, and
Vietnamese. A partial list of languages which may be typed in
Roman transliterations from their non-Roman scripts includes
Greek, Russian, Serbo-Croatian, Ukrainian, Macedonian, Old Church
Slavonic, Sanskrit, Persian, Hebrew, Arabic, Japanese, Chinese,
Tamil, and Malayalam. International Greek handles ancient and
modern and Greek. Any combination of breathings and accents may be
placed anywhere, including above capitals. Makrons and the
short-vowel marker are also available. International Cyrillic
supports Russian (including pre-revolutionary), Byelorussian,
Ukrainian, Serbo-Croatian, Bulgarian, Macedonian, Kashmir,
Kirghiz, Mongolian, Kurdish, and several others.
International Phonetic, based on the International Phonetic
Alphabet, is self-explanatory for anyone involved in phonology.
There are many unusual characters and diacritical signs in this
font. The fonts are available in 12 and 24 point size for any
Macintosh with any word processor and the ImageWriter I or II.
Three of the fonts use proportional spacing and the Phonetic is
mono-spaced.

DESCRIPTION:
Set of fonts designed for use by linguists and others who make
use of phonetic transcription systems.
The new fonts Linguist G and Linguist NY are modeled on the Geneva
and New York fonts and include 218 printing symbols (120 not found
in any standard Macintosh fonts) in 9, 10, 12, 18, 20 and 24
points sizes. The new symbols include the most frequently used
symbols from the I.P.A. and other transcription systems, along
with orthographic symbols not contained in the original fonts.
Fonts can be co-resident with Geneva and New York, so symbols from
standard and MAC THE LINGUIST fonts can be mixed in documents. MAC
THE LINGUIST can be used with MacWrite, MacPaint and other
Macintosh applications and supports Italic, Superscript and
other'style' enhancements. Documentation includes installation
instruction, Key Cap charts (showing all keyboard locations,
including 'dead key' symbols), Index (showing how to type each
symbol, typical articulatory description, example of use, and
ASCII code).Hints for learning and using fonts easily and
effectively and information for using with Laserfonts.

DESCRIPTION:
International Phonetic Alphabet with diacritics, pronunciation
symbols, accent and stress signs, SIL and MacTransliterator.
Overstrike keys with automatic non-deleting backspacing allow fast
insertion of accents, umlauts, and a wide variety of other
diacritical marks such as 37 in IPA, 53 in SIL, 49 in Semitica and
50 in Roman-MacTransliterator. All of these can be joined with any
letter, lower or upper case. A mini space bar, which advances the
insertion point a single pixel, facilitates fine-tuning of
diacritical marks. Has a vertical bar for continuous vertical
columns, any number of lines in length. High quality printing. The
IPA font is selected directly from the font menu of MacWrite (ISPN
12784-530) or MicroSoft Word (ISPN 53150-731) for automatic
footnoting. Instantly transforms the keyboard to and from the
IPA, SIL and Roman. Style variations include bold, italic,
underline, outline, shadow, superscript and subscript. Provides
10, 12, 20, and 24 point font with high-quality printing of the
transliteration symbols of Hebrew, Arabic, Coptic, Greek (SBL
system), and most other languages. Includes the complete character
sets of 75 languages which include Albanian, Anglo-Saxon, Basque,
French, Catalonian, Croation, Czech (Bohemian), Danish,
Dutch, English, Esperanto, Esthonian, Finnish, German, Hawaiian,
Hungarian, Icelandic, Irish, Italian, Latin, Latvian, Lithuanian,
Maltese, Norwegian, Polish, Portuguese, Rumanian, Samoan, Slovak,
Slovenian, Spanish, Swedish, Tagalog, Turkish, Welsh, and
Wendish. The American Indian languages include Chippewa (Ojibway
and Otchipwe), Choctaw, Cree, Dakota (Sioux), Eskimo, Hupa,
Iroquoian, Kalispel, Kwakiutl, Muskokee (Creek), Navaho, Osage,
Tsimshian, and Zuni. The African languages include Acholi,
Afrikaans, Bantu (Zulu and Xosa), Bobangi, Buluba-Lulua,
Chikaranga, Fulani-Adamawa, Ga, Kanuri, Kongo, Lu-Ganda, Masai,
Mashona (Chiswina), Mole, Namaquah-Hottentot, Nyika, Shuna,
Swahili, Tebele, Temne, Umbundu, Wolof, Yao, Yoruba, and
Zulu-Kafir. SIL stands for Summer Institute of Linguistics. Not
copy-protected.
